The Meaning Behind The Song: 7 Years by Lukas Graham

Title: 7 Years

Artist: Lukas Graham

Writer/Composer: Morten “Pilo” Pilegaard, Lukas Forchhammer, Morten “Rissi” Ristorp, Don Stefano

Album: Lukas Graham (Blue Album) (2015)

Release Date: June 16, 2015

Genre: Pop, Pop Rap, Ballad, Pop-Rock, Adult Alternative, Adult Contemporary, Piano, Scandinavia, Danmark

Producer: Morten “Pilo” Pilegaard & Future Animals

In “7 Years”, the Danish group Lukas Graham reflect on their life and wonder about growing older. The song takes us through various ages in the life of the lead singer, Lukas Forchhammer. We start off at age seven, with the line “Once, I was seven years old, my mama told me ‘Go make yourself some friends, or you’ll be lonely’”. This line speaks to the innocence and simplicity of childhood. The advice given by his mother reflects the importance of forming meaningful connections with others.

The song then moves on to age eleven, where we are presented with the line “Once, I was eleven years old, my daddy told me ‘Go get yourself a wife, or you’ll be lonely’”. Here, we see the influence of parents and the desire for companionship and connection. The song suggests that the need for love and connection is something that stays with us throughout our lives.

As the song progresses, we reach age twenty, where Lukas reflects on his dreams and aspirations. He says, “I always had that dream like my daddy before me, so I started writing songs, I started writing stories.” This line hints at the importance of following our passions and pursuing our dreams. Lukas’s desire to write songs and stories is a way for him to express himself, to share his thoughts and emotions with others.

The chorus repeats the line “Once, I was [age] years old, my story got told”, indicating that each age brings new experiences and stories to tell. The song highlights the notion that life is a journey, filled with ups and downs, triumphs and challenges.
